Four survivors of grooming gangs are demanding the resignation of safeguarding minister Jess Phillips before they will consider rejoining the inquiry into these serious allegations. This situation highlights the ongoing tensions and challenges within the government as it grapples with public trust and accountability in handling such sensitive issues. The survivors' call for action underscores the importance of addressing their concerns to ensure justice and support for victims.
